Řešení běžných chyb nasazení Azure
Tento článek popisuje běžné chyby nasazení Azure a poskytuje informace o řešeních. Prostředky Azure je možné nasadit pomocí Azure Resource Manager (šablon ARM) nebo souborů Bicep. Pokud nemůžete najít kód vaší chyby nasazení, přečtěte si téma popisujícívyhledání kódu chyby.
Pokud váš kód chyby není uvedený, odešlete GitHub problému. Na pravé straně stránky vyberte Váš názor. V dolní části stránky v části Zpětná vazba vyberte Tato stránka.
Kódy chyb
| Kód chyby | Omezení rizik | Další informace |
|---|---|---|
| AccountNameInvalid | Dodržujte omezení pojmenování pro účty úložiště. | Překlad názvu účtu úložiště |
| AccountPropertyCannotBeSet | Zkontrolujte dostupné vlastnosti účtu úložiště. | účty úložiště |
| AllocationFailed | Cluster nebo oblast nemá k dispozici prostředky nebo nepodporuje požadovanou velikost virtuálního počítače. Zkuste požadavek zopakovat později nebo požádejte o jinou velikost virtuálního počítače. | Potíže se zřizováním a přidělením pro Linux Potíže se zřizováním a přidělením pro Windows Řešení potíží s chybami přidělení |
| AnotherOperationInProgress | Počkejte na dokončení souběžné operace. | |
| AuthorizationFailed | Váš účet nebo objekt služby nemá dostatečný přístup k dokončení nasazení. Zkontrolujte roli, do které váš účet patří, a její přístup k oboru nasazení. Tato chyba se může zobrazit, když není zaregistrovaný požadovaný poskytovatel prostředků. |
Řízení přístupu na základě role Azure (Azure RBAC) Řešení registrace |
| BadRequest | Odeslali jste hodnoty nasazení, které neodpovídají tomu, co očekává Resource Manager. Pomoc s řešením potíží najdete ve vnitřní stavové zprávě. | Referenční informace k šablonám Podporovaná umístění |
| Konflikt | Požadujete operaci, která není povolená v aktuálním stavu prostředku. Změna velikosti disku je například povolená pouze při vytváření virtuálního počítače nebo při jeho přidělení. | |
| DeploymentActiveAndUneditable | Počkejte na dokončení souběžného nasazení do této skupiny prostředků. | |
| DeploymentFailedCleanUp | Když nasadíte v úplném režimu, všechny prostředky, které nejsou v šabloně, se odstraní. Tato chyba se zobrazí, když nemáte dostatečná oprávnění k odstranění všech prostředků, které nejsou v šabloně. Pokud se chcete této chybě vyhnout, změňte režim nasazení na přírůstkový. | Režimy nasazení Azure Resource Manageru |
| DeploymentNameInvalidCharacters | Název nasazení může obsahovat pouze písmena, číslice, (-) spojovník, tečku (.) nebo podtržítko (_) . |
|
| DeploymentNameLengthLimitExceeded | Názvy nasazení jsou omezené na 64 znaků. | |
| DeploymentFailed | Chyba DeploymentFailed je obecná chyba, která neposkytuje podrobnosti, které potřebujete k vyřešení chyby. V podrobnostech o chybě vyhledejte kód chyby, který obsahuje další informace. | Vyhledání kódu chyby |
| DeploymentQuotaExceeded | Pokud dosáhnete limitu 800 nasazení na skupinu prostředků, odstraňte nasazení z historie, která už nepotřebujete. | Řešení chyby při překročení počtu nasazení 800 |
| DeploymentJobSizeExceeded | Zjednodušte si šablonu a zmenšete velikost. | Řešení chyb velikosti šablony |
| DnsRecordInUse | Název záznamu DNS musí být jedinečný. Zadejte jiný název. | |
| ImageNotFound | Zkontrolujte nastavení image virtuálního počítače. | |
| InternalServerError | Způsobený dočasným problémem. Zkuste nasazení zopakovat. | |
| InUseSubnetCannotBeDeleted | K této chybě může dojít při pokusu o aktualizaci prostředku, pokud proces požadavku odstraní a vytvoří prostředek. Nezapomeňte zadat všechny nezměněné hodnoty. | Aktualizace prostředku |
| InvalidAuthenticationTokenTenant | Získejte přístupový token pro příslušného tenanta. Token můžete získat pouze z tenanta, do které patří váš účet. | |
| InvalidContentLink | Pravděpodobně jste se pokusili vytvořit odkaz na vnořenou šablonu, která není k dispozici. Zkontrolujte identifikátor URI, který jste pro vnořenou šablonu poskytli. Pokud šablona existuje v účtu úložiště, ujistěte se, že je identifikátor URI přístupný. Možná budete muset předat token SAS. V současné době nemůžete vytvořit propojení se šablonou, která je v účtu úložiště za Azure Storage firewallem. Zvažte přesunutí šablony do jiného úložiště, například do GitHub. | Propojené šablony |
| InvalidDeploymentLocation | Při nasazování na úrovni předplatného jste pro dříve použitý název nasazení poskytli jiné umístění. | Nasazení na úrovni předplatného |
| Neplatný parametr | Jedna z hodnot, které jste pro prostředek poskytli, neodpovídá očekávané hodnotě. Tato chyba může být důsledkem mnoha různých podmínek. Heslo může být například nedostatečné nebo může být nesprávný název objektu blob. Chybová zpráva by měla obsahovat informace o tom, kterou hodnotu je potřeba opravit. | |
| InvalidRequestContent | Hodnoty nasazení buď zahrnují hodnoty, které se nerozpoznají, nebo chybí požadované hodnoty. Potvrďte hodnoty pro váš typ prostředku. | Referenční informace k šablonám |
| Formát invalidRequestFormat | Povolte protokolování ladění při spuštění nasazení a ověřte obsah požadavku. | Protokolování ladění |
| InvalidResourceLocation | Zadejte jedinečný název účtu úložiště. | Překlad názvu účtu úložiště |
| InvalidResourceNamespace | Zkontrolujte obor názvů prostředků, který jste zadali ve vlastnosti type. | Referenční informace k šablonám |
| InvalidResourceReference | Prostředek buď ještě neexistuje, nebo je nesprávně odkazován. Zkontrolujte, jestli potřebujete přidat závislost. Ověřte, že vaše použití referenční funkce obsahuje požadované parametry pro váš scénář. | Řešení závislostí |
| InvalidResourceType | Zkontrolujte typ prostředku, který jste zadali ve vlastnosti type. | Referenční informace k šablonám |
| InvalidSubscriptionRegistrationState | Zaregistrujte své předplatné u poskytovatele prostředků. | Řešení registrace |
| InvalidTemplateDeployment InvalidTemplate |
Zkontrolujte chyby v syntaxi šablony. | Řešení neplatné šablony |
| InvalidTemplateCircularDependency | Odeberte nepotřebné závislosti. | Řešení cyklických závislostí |
| JobSizeExceeded | Zjednodušte si šablonu a zmenšete velikost. | Řešení chyb velikosti šablony |
| LinkedAuthorizationFailed | Zkontrolujte, jestli váš účet patří do stejného tenanta jako skupina prostředků, do které nasazujete. | |
| LinkedInvalidPropertyId | ID prostředku se nevyřeší. Zkontrolujte, že jste pro ID prostředku poskytli všechny požadované hodnoty. Například ID předplatného, název skupiny prostředků, typ prostředku, název nadřazeného prostředku (pokud je to potřeba) a název prostředku. | |
| Umístění Vyžádá se | Zadejte umístění prostředku. | Nastavení umístění |
| MismatchingResourceSegments | Ujistěte se, že vnořený prostředek má správný počet segmentů v názvu a typu. | Řešení segmentů prostředků |
| MissingRegistrationForLocation | Zkontrolujte stav registrace poskytovatele prostředků a podporovaná umístění. | Řešení registrace |
| MissingSubscriptionRegistration | Zaregistrujte své předplatné u poskytovatele prostředků. | Řešení registrace |
| NoRegisteredProviderFound | Zkontrolujte stav registrace poskytovatele prostředků. | Řešení registrace |
| NotFound | Možná se pokoušíte paralelně nasadit závislý prostředek s nadřazeným prostředekem. Zkontrolujte, jestli potřebujete přidat závislost. | Řešení závislostí |
| OperationNotAllowed | Nasazení se pokouší o operaci, která překračuje kvótu pro předplatné, skupinu prostředků nebo oblast. Pokud je to možné, upravte nasazení tak, aby zůstalo v rámci kvót. V opačném případě zvažte žádost o změnu kvót. | Řešení kvót |
| ParentResourceNotFound | Před vytvořením podřízených prostředků se ujistěte, že existuje nadřazený prostředek. | Překlad nadřazeného prostředku |
| PasswordTooLong | Možná jste vybrali heslo s příliš mnoha znaky nebo jste před jeho předáním jako parametr převedli hodnotu hesla na zabezpečený řetězec. Pokud šablona obsahuje parametr řetězce zabezpečení, není nutné převádět hodnotu na zabezpečený řetězec. Zadejte hodnotu hesla jako text. | |
| PrivateIPAddressInReservedRange | Zadaná IP adresa zahrnuje rozsah adres, který vyžaduje Azure. Změňte IP adresu, abyste se vyhnuli vyhrazenému rozsahu. | IP adresy |
| PrivateIPAddressNotInSubnet | Zadaná IP adresa je mimo rozsah podsítě. Změňte IP adresu tak, aby spadá do rozsahu podsítě. | IP adresy |
| Vlastnost PropertyChangeNotAllowed | U nasazených prostředků není možné změnit některé vlastnosti. Při aktualizaci prostředku omezte změny na povolené vlastnosti. | Aktualizace prostředku |
| RequestDisallowedByPolicy | Vaše předplatné obsahuje zásady prostředků, které brání akci, kterou se během nasazování pokoušíte provést. Vyhledejte zásadu, která akci blokuje. Pokud je to možné, změňte nasazení tak, aby splňovalo omezení zásad. | Řešení zásad |
| ReservedResourceName | Zadejte název prostředku, který neobsahuje vyhrazený název. | Názvy rezervovaných prostředků |
| ResourceGroupBeingDeleted | Počkejte na dokončení odstranění. | |
| ResourceGroupNotFound | Zkontrolujte název cílové skupiny prostředků pro nasazení. Cílová skupina prostředků už musí existovat ve vašem předplatném. Zkontrolujte kontext předplatného. | Azure CLI PowerShell |
| ResourceNotFound | Vaše nasazení odkazuje na prostředek, který nelze vyřešit. Ověřte, že vaše použití referenční funkce obsahuje parametry vyžadované pro váš scénář. | Překlad odkazů |
| ResourceQuotaExceeded | Nasazení se pokouší vytvořit prostředky, které překračují kvótu pro předplatné, skupinu prostředků nebo oblast. Pokud je to možné, upravte infrastrukturu tak, aby zůstala v rámci kvót. V opačném případě zvažte žádost o změnu kvót. | Řešení kvót |
| SkuNotAvailable | Vyberte položku SKU (například velikost virtuálního počítače), která je k dispozici pro vybrané umístění. | Vyřešit SKU |
| StorageAccountAlreadyExists StorageAccountAlreadyTaken |
Zadejte jedinečný název účtu úložiště. | Přeložit název účtu úložiště |
| StorageAccountNotFound | Ověřte předplatné, skupinu prostředků a název účtu úložiště, který se pokoušíte použít. | |
| SubnetsNotInSameVnet | Virtuální počítač může mít jenom jednu virtuální síť. Při nasazování několika síťových adaptérů se ujistěte, že patří do stejné virtuální sítě. | Více síťových karet |
| SubscriptionNotFound | Zadané předplatné pro nasazení není k dispozici. Je možné, že ID předplatného je chybné, uživatel, který šablonu nasazuje, nemá dostatečná oprávnění k nasazení do předplatného nebo ID předplatného je ve špatném formátu. Při použití vnořených nasazení k nasazení napříč oboryzadejte identifikátor GUID předplatného. | |
| SubscriptionNotRegistered | Při nasazování prostředku musí být poskytovatel prostředků zaregistrován pro vaše předplatné. Když použijete šablonu Azure Resource Manager pro nasazení, poskytovatel prostředků se automaticky zaregistruje v předplatném. V některých případech se automatická registrace nedokončila v čase. Chcete-li se tomuto přerušované chybě vyhnout, zaregistrujte poskytovatele prostředků před nasazením. | Vyřešit registraci |
| TemplateResourceCircularDependency | Odeberte zbytečné závislosti. | Vyřešit cyklické závislosti |
| TooManyTargetResourceGroups | Snižte počet skupin prostředků pro jedno nasazení. | Nasazení mezi různými obory |